Top 10 celebrities in Nigeria of 2022

Nigeria, of course is one of the most prestigious entertainment industries in the world.

From the music industry to the movie industry, celebrities have excel to great heights both nationally and internationally.

Here, Glamsquad have gathered the top 10 celebrities in Nigeria of 2022 based on international recognitions and social media followers.

1. Davido

Nigerian artist, Davido is top on the list no doubt. He has maintained his title as the most followed Nigerian celebrity on Instagram for the fifth consecutive year with 25.7 million followers. It’s interesting to note that he has more Instagram followers than some of the biggest superstars in the world.

Davido is also reputable internationally. He has won two BET awards for Best International act 2014 and 2018. He has also performed in the 02 arena at London.

The 29-year-old has collaboration with international artists like Chris Brown, Meek Mill, Khalid and others.

2. Wizkid

Grammy award winner, Ayodeji Ibrahim Balogun, known professionally as Wizkid, has 15.6 million followers on Instagram and even singer, Yemi Alade has more. It is no surprise as Wizkid prefers to live a quit life on social media.

The 32-year-old songwriter is of course well-known for his international achievements like wining the prestigious Grammy award, shutting down the O2 arena and collaborating with top artists like Beyoncé, Chris Brown, Justin Bieber and many more.

SFTOS and Made in Lagos, Wizkid’s smash singles, premiered at No. 2 on the US World Albums chart (Billboard chart). He was also the first Afrobeats musician to have his contribution to Drake’s song “One Dance” recognized by Guinness World Records.

3. Burna Boy

Nigerian artist, Damini Ebunoluwa Ogulu, known professionally as Burna Boy, have grown rapidly in the music industry both nationally and internationally. He has a total of 12.1 million followers on Instagram.

He is also the first Nigerian to be nominated for two Grammy Awards in a row, in 2021. With over 20 national and international honors.

The 31-year-old has won a Grammy award and his last album “Love, Damini” proves his international collaborations with the likes of Khalid, Ed Sheeran and others.

4. Tiwa Savage

Nigerian singer-songwriter, Tiwa Savage has proven to be influential in the music industry for over a decade. It is safe to say she is the most consistent Nigerian artist with back-to-back hit tracks.

Savage, who was already a huge success when her debut album Once Upon a Time was published in 2013, continued to release singles and expand her global reach by performing at foreign festivals and venues over the next decade.

Tiwa Savage has 15.7 million followers on Instagram.

5. Yemi Alade

One of the less contentious celebrities is Yemi Alade. She posts a lot of pictures of her gorgeous body and her career, but there isn’t much controversy on her Instagram page.

Mama Africa, as she is affectionately known in Nigeria, have worked alongside Oscar and Grammy winner Angelique Kidjo, a Beninese singer-songwriter of Nigerian descent.
Yemi Alade’s Shekere has over 9 million views on YouTube alone. She also recorded a song called “Oh My Gosh” with renowned rapper Rick Ross.

She has over 17 million followers on Instagram and is recognize as one of the top female artist in Nigeria.

6. 2Baba

2Baba, also known as 2face, began his musical career with the defunct Plantashun Boiz and has since gone on to become a huge celebrity in Nigerian music. 2Baba is a Nigerian Afropop artist who changed his name from Tuface to 2Baba in 2016. In 2015, 2Baba won the MTV Europe and Best African Act Awards for the first time. “African Queen,” 2Baba’s 2006 song, received rave reviews all around the world.

2baba has 7.6 million followers on Instagram.

7. Funke Akindele

Nollywood actress and producer, Funke Akindele is an important figure in the Nigerian industry. She rose to fame with her movie “Jenifa’s Diary” which was released in 2008. Funke’s movie, Omo Ghetto;. The Saga won its 1st International Award at META Cinema Conference in the UAE.

Funke Akindele is currently pursuing a career in politics as The governorship cand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in Lagos, Olajide Adediran, picked her as his running mate for the 2023 general election.

Funke Akindele has 15.6 million followers on Instagram.

8. Genevieve Nnaji

Genevieve has been first for a number of things, including the popularity of her Netflix movie, Lionheart. This was her directorial debut, and it was the first Nigerian film to be an original Netflix movie. The film premiered at the Toronto International Film Festival. Lionheart was Nigeria’s first Oscar submission. Unfortunately, the film was rejected because the majority of the language was in English.

Genevieve has won various honors since her debut as an actor, including the Africa Movie Award for Best Actress in a Leading Role in 2005, which she was the first actor to win. The Nigerian government has made her a member of the Order of the Federal Republic.

Genevieve Nnaji has 8.5 million followers on Instagram.

9. Tems

Temilade Openiyi, known professionally as Tems, is a Nigerian singer, songwriter, and record producer who rose to fame when she released her first EP, “Time Swap EP” in 2013. Her feature in Wizkid’s “Essence” has brought her a lot of international recognitions.

Tems has since won won international act at 2022 BET, collaborated with international artists like Drake, Justin Bieber, and most recently wrote a song for American artist, Rihanna titled “Lift Me Up” to feature in the upcoming “Black Panther: Wakanda Forever” movie. She also sang a cover for “No woman, No cry” for the movie.

Tems has 2.9 million followers on Instagram.

10. Kizz Daniel

Oluwatobiloba Daniel Anidugbe, better known by his stage name Kizz Daniel, is a Nigerian singer and songwriter who rose to fame with his banging hit single “Woju” released in 2016.

Kizz Daniel is not big on international collaboration but has performed in the renowned O2 arena in London.

Kizz is one of the major artist in Nigeria right now. His famous single “Cough (ODO)” is making rounds both nationally and internationally.

Kizz Daniel has 9.9 million followers on Instagram.
